Exegesis

The verse begins with the Hiphil imperative harcheq {הַרְחֵק | har-ḥēq} ‘remove’, which applies to both shav {שָׁוְא | šāw} ‘emptiness’ and devar-kazav {דְבַר־כָּזָב | də-war-qā-zāḇ} ‘word of deceit’, intensifying the plea for moral integrity.

In contextProverbs 30:8

Remove from me emptiness and speech of lies; poverty and riches do not give to me; feed me with bread of my portion .
